Pair of Val Saint Lambert Crystal Decanters – Ruby Red & Cobalt Blue – c. 1900

An elegant pair of hand-cut crystal decanters by the prestigious Belgian manufacturer Val Saint Lambert, dating to the late 19th – early 20th century.

Both decanters are crafted from colored crystal – one in deep ruby red and the other in rich cobalt blue – and are finely cut in the classic “taille riche” tradition. The decoration features intricate cross-hatched lattice patterns, stylized leaf motifs, and beautifully executed star-cut bases, demonstrating the high level of craftsmanship associated with the finest European crystal workshops.

The tall, slender form, combined with the brilliance of the cut and the intensity of the color, gives these pieces a refined and timeless elegance, ideal for display or use on a distinguished dining or wedding table.

Each decanter is topped with a faceted stopper; these are later replacements but fit perfectly and remain visually harmonious with the overall design.

Condition:
Good antique condition with normal signs of age and use.

Dimensions:

Ruby red decanter: height approx. 30 cm, diameter approx. 8 cm
Cobalt blue decanter: height approx. 30 cm, diameter approx. 7.5 cm

Period: circa 1880–1910

A refined and decorative pair, showcasing the craftsmanship and reputation of Val Saint Lambert, highly sought-after by collectors of fine crystal.
